A new learner use blender to do a model

Hi, I'm a new unity learner.
I want to use Blender2.6 to do a human model.
And I export the model to Unity3.5 when I finish the model.
After I import the model.
The model in Unity was deformation.
I don't know what happend?

There's one important thing that you must do to ensure that your model exports correctly.

In blender, select all objects in the scene (in object mode, press A and check that all of them are lit with the orange outline) then press CONTROL A and then APPLY POSITION APPLY ROTATION APPLY SCALE then export again.

Usually, deformation occurs because of uneven scale between objects.

Additionally, you need to be sure that object dimension is 'realistic'. As a matter of fact, the original blender cube of a new scene, is a 2meter by 2meter wide object, that will be the same size in unity!

So make sure that your objects dimensions are in the units rather than in the hundreds of units.
